Experience: Greg Glass practiced both criminal trial and appellate law over 40 years before his election to the bench, including 150 jury trials in both State and Federal Courts. Republicanshave also introduced billsto further investigate election fraud, to limit the states early voting period from two weeks to one, and to set earlier deadlines for handing in mail ballots. Progressive groupslast month submitted roughly 38,000 petition signatures to get the proposedcharter amendmentincluded on the May municipal election ballot, a move San Antonio City Attorney Andy Segoviasigned off on last week. But even if they miss that goal, voters can expect to see the slate of proposed changes, collectively known as the Justice Charter, to the city charter on the November 2023 ballot because the signatures collected are valid for six months.
